(March 20, 2026) — The public is invited to a special historical presentation, Three Centuries and Counting at Thirty Mile Island: The Old Burial Yard, on April 12, 2026 at 1:00 p.m. at the Haddam Firehouse in Higganum.
Local historian Dan MacNeil will lead an engaging exploration of Haddam’s Old Burial Yard at Thirty Mile Island, one of the community’s most historically significant sites. The program will highlight the burial ground’s role in the region’s early settlement, the stories of the people connected to it, and the recent research that has uncovered deeper insights into Haddam’s past.
This event offers a rare opportunity to learn more about a landmark that spans more than three centuries of local history, shedding light on how the early inhabitants of the area lived, worked, and shaped the town we know today.
Refreshments will be served. Admission is free. Donations are appreciated. This presentation is sponsored by The Old Burial Yard at Thirty Mile Island, an organization dedicated to preserving and interpreting this historically important site for future generations.
